Hi, guys.
I recently submitted my project to the Scratch Design Studio. It had been about 3 days, and the views on my project have increased dramatically, yet no matter how many times I look, I can never seem to find it under the Design Studio section of the front page. Why is this?
Thanks to everyone who answers!
Offline
Well, there's only three projects shown at a time on the frontpage. Considering there's probably over a hundred projects in it, it's not surprising it hasn't appeared (it chooses three random ones). It will eventually if you keep refreshing.
